🧊 A Lost World Found Beneath 2 km of Antarctic Ice

Scientists have uncovered evidence of an ancient landscape buried deep under Antarctica’s ice, revealing that the frozen continent once had rivers, vegetation, and a milder climate millions of years ago.

Key Facts:

• Sediments were found beneath ~2 km of ice in East Antarctica

• Fossil pollen and plant residues date back ~34 million years

• Indicates Antarctica once supported flowing water and vegetation

Expert Insight:
This discovery helps scientists better understand how Earth shifted from a warm climate to an ice-covered planet — crucial for improving long-term climate and ice-sheet models.
